St Patricks played Waterford at the Premier Division of Ireland on April 19. The match kicked off 18:45 UTC and ended in a draw 1 - 1.

Maleace Asamoah scored the first goal on the 13th minute of the game followed by a goal from Brandon Kavanagh who made the final score 1-1.

St Patricks kicked off the game with Danny Rogers, Anthony Breslin, Conor Keeley, Joe Redmond, Luke Turner, Brandon Kavanagh, Jamie Lennon, Aaron Bolger who got substituted by Ruairi Keating on the 62nd minute, Alex Nolan who got substituted by Jake Mulraney on the 63rd minute, Kian Leavy who got substituted by Chris Forrester on the 62nd minute and Mason Melia who got substituted by Romal Palmer on the 79th minute as starters, with Chris Forrester, Cian Kavanagh, Ruairi Keating, Jason Mcclelland, Ryan McLaughlin, Jake Mulraney, Romal Palmer, Arran Pettifer and Marcelo Pitaluga on the bench.

Waterford's starting eleven were Sam Sargeant, Darragh Leahy, Robert McCourt, Grant Horton, Darragh Power, Rowan Mcdonald, Harvey Macadam, Ben Mccormack who got substituted by Romeo Akachukwu on the 77th minute, Connor Parsons who got substituted by Dean McMenamy on the 90th minute, Padraig Amond and Maleace Asamoah who got substituted by Christie Pattisson on the 71st minute, with Romeo Akachukwu, Gbemi Arubi, Matthew Connor, Joseph Forde, Dean McMenamy, Niall OKeeffe, Christie Pattisson, Kacper Radkowski and Connor Salisbury on the bench.

Referee showed the yellow card 6 times throughout the game. Robert McCourt, Mason Melia, Maleace Asamoah, Aaron Bolger, Ben Mccormack and Chris Forrester were the ones to receive it.

Head-to-head

St Patricks and Waterford have met 6 times since June 2021. St Patricks have won twice, 2 matches ended in a draw while Waterford have also won twice. The most recent match between them took place on March 4, 2024 at the Premier Division of Ireland where Waterford won 3-1. St Patricks have scored 8 goals in these 6 head-to-head matches in total and Waterford have also scored 8. So, overall, St Patricks and Waterford have almost identical head-to-head record against each other in their recent history.

St Patricks have won 4 of their 10 matches in Premier Division, drawing 2 and having 4 defeats this season. They have scored 10 goals - 1.00 per match, conceding 9 - 0.90 per match. Waterford have won 3 of their 10 matches in Premier Division, drawing 3 and having 4 defeats this season. They have scored 11 goals - 1.10 per match, conceding 11 - 1.10 per match.
